      1 //===- StripSymbols.cpp - Strip symbols and debug info from a module ------===//
      2 //
      3 //                     The LLVM Compiler Infrastructure
      4 //
      5 // This file is distributed under the University of Illinois Open Source
      6 // License. See LICENSE.TXT for details.
      7 //
      8 //===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
      9 //
     10 // The StripSymbols transformation implements code stripping. Specifically, it
     11 // can delete:
     12 //
     13 //   * names for virtual registers
     14 //   * symbols for internal globals and functions
     15 //   * debug information
     16 //
     17 // Note that this transformation makes code much less readable, so it should
     18 // only be used in situations where the 'strip' utility would be used, such as
     19 // reducing code size or making it harder to reverse engineer code.
     20 //
     21 //===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//

    290 /// Remove any debug info for global variables/functions in the given module for
    291 /// which said global variable/function no longer exists (i.e. is null).
    292 ///
    293 /// Debugging information is encoded in llvm IR using metadata. This is designed
    294 /// such a way that debug info for symbols preserved even if symbols are
    295 /// optimized away by the optimizer. This special pass removes debug info for
    296 /// such symbols.
    297 bool StripDeadDebugInfo::runOnModule(Module &M) {
    298   if (skipModule(M))
    299     return false;
    300 
    301   bool Changed = false;
    302 
    303   LLVMContext &C = M.getContext();
    304 
    305   // Find all debug info in F. This is actually overkill in terms of what we
    306   // want to do, but we want to try and be as resilient as possible in the face
    307   // of potential debug info changes by using the formal interfaces given to us
    308   // as much as possible.
    309   DebugInfoFinder F;
    310   F.processModule(M);
    311 
    312   // For each compile unit, find the live set of global variables/functions and
    313   // replace the current list of potentially dead global variables/functions
    314   // with the live list.
    315   SmallVector<Metadata *, 64> LiveGlobalVariables;
    316   DenseSet<DIGlobalVariableExpression *> VisitedSet;
    317 
    318   std::set<DIGlobalVariableExpression *> LiveGVs;
    319   for (GlobalVariable &GV : M.globals()) {
    320     SmallVector<DIGlobalVariableExpression *, 1> GVEs;
    321     GV.getDebugInfo(GVEs);
    322     for (auto *GVE : GVEs)
    323       LiveGVs.insert(GVE);
    324   }
    325 
    326   std::set<DICompileUnit *> LiveCUs;
    327   // Any CU referenced from a subprogram is live.
    328   for (DISubprogram *SP : F.subprograms()) {
    329     if (SP->getUnit())
    330       LiveCUs.insert(SP->getUnit());
    331   }
    332 
    333   bool HasDeadCUs = false;
    334   for (DICompileUnit *DIC : F.compile_units()) {
    335     // Create our live global variable list.
    336     bool GlobalVariableChange = false;
    337     for (auto *DIG : DIC->getGlobalVariables()) {
    338       if (DIG->getExpression() && DIG->getExpression()->isConstant())
    339         LiveGVs.insert(DIG);
    340 
    341       // Make sure we only visit each global variable only once.
    342       if (!VisitedSet.insert(DIG).second)
    343         continue;
    344 
    345       // If a global variable references DIG, the global variable is live.
    346       if (LiveGVs.count(DIG))
    347         LiveGlobalVariables.push_back(DIG);
    348       else
    349         GlobalVariableChange = true;
    350     }
    351 
    352     if (!LiveGlobalVariables.empty())
    353       LiveCUs.insert(DIC);
    354     else if (!LiveCUs.count(DIC))
    355       HasDeadCUs = true;
    356 
    357     // If we found dead global variables, replace the current global
    358     // variable list with our new live global variable list.
    359     if (GlobalVariableChange) {
    360       DIC->replaceGlobalVariables(MDTuple::get(C, LiveGlobalVariables));
    361       Changed = true;
    362     }
    363 
    364     // Reset lists for the next iteration.
    365     LiveGlobalVariables.clear();
    366   }
    367 
    368   if (HasDeadCUs) {
    369     // Delete the old node and replace it with a new one
    370     NamedMDNode *NMD = M.getOrInsertNamedMetadata("llvm.dbg.cu");
    371     NMD->clearOperands();
    372     if (!LiveCUs.empty()) {
    373       for (DICompileUnit *CU : LiveCUs)
    374         NMD->addOperand(CU);
    375     }
    376     Changed = true;
    377   }
    378 
    379   return Changed;
    380 }
